Host Lineage: Treponema primitia; Treponema; Spirochaetaceae; Spirochaetales; Spirochaetes; Bacteria

General Information: Treponema primitia was one of the first organisms isolated in pure culture from the hindgut of the Pacific dampwood termite Zootermopsis angusticollis. The physiology of this organism has been studied to provide information on its contribution to the growth and survival of termites.
